로컬저장소에서 원격저장소와의 동기화를 위해 pull을 하였지만 아래와 같은 에러가 뜸.
error: Your local changes to the following files would be overwritten by merge
로컬에서 변경한 파일이 원격저장소의 파일 내용과 달라져 충돌을 일으킴.
로컬에서 변경한 파일을 stash하여 일시적으로 저장하고 pull을 수행한 후 stash 내용을 다시 적용하면 됨.
- git stash save "my changes" //로컬 변경 사항 stash하기
- git pull origin <브랜치 이름> //pull 수행하기
- git stash apply //stash 적용하기
- 로컬저장소에서 충돌파일 확인 후 해결하기